/* Helper function for svr4_update_solib_event_breakpoints. */
-static int
-svr4_update_solib_event_breakpoint (struct breakpoint *b, void *arg)
+static bool
+svr4_update_solib_event_breakpoint (struct breakpoint *b)
{
struct bp_location *loc;
if (b->type != bp_shlib_event)
{
/* Continue iterating. */
- return 0;
+ return false;
}
for (loc = b->loc; loc != NULL; loc = loc->next)
}
/* Continue iterating. */
- return 0;
+ return false;
}
/* Enable or disable optional solib event breakpoints as appropriate.
static void
svr4_update_solib_event_breakpoints (void)
{
- iterate_over_breakpoints (svr4_update_solib_event_breakpoint, NULL);
+ iterate_over_breakpoints (svr4_update_solib_event_breakpoint);
}
/* Create and register solib event breakpoints. PROBES is an array